it's not the same
There is a stark difference between tidying up and cleaning.
Tidying up seeks to please aesthetically. It focuses on appearance. Cleaning touches roots, removing unwanted dirt or residue. It's more in-depth. What's the use of being neat, being pleasing to the eye, when behind it all is a thick dust buildup? |
